Role Description This is a full-time, on-site role for a Pharma Injectables (Sterile) Plant Production Manager based in Bahadurgarh. The Production Manager will oversee end-to-end sterile injectable manufacturing operations, including planning, scheduling, and execution of production batches in compliance with GMP and regulatory guidelines. Day-to-day responsibilities include managing production teams, monitoring aseptic processes, coordinating with quality assurance and maintenance, and ensuring adherence to SOPs and safety standards. The role involves optimizing production capacity, reducing downtime, managing inventory of raw materials and packaging components, and supporting validation and qualification activities. The Production Manager will also maintain documentation, support audits and inspections, drive continuous improvement initiatives, and train team members on best practices in sterile manufacturing.
Qualifications
  • Extensive experience (around 10 years) in sterile injectables manufacturing, with proven responsibility for plant or production management.
  • Strong knowledge of GMP, WHO guidelines, aseptic processing, cleanroom operations, and regulatory compliance for injectable products.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ead and supervise production teams, allocate resources effectively, and maintain a safe working environment.
  • Proficiency in production planning, process optimization, troubleshooting, and coordination with quality, maintenance, and supply chain functions.
  • Solid documentation skills, including preparation and review of SOPs, batch manufacturing records, deviation reports, and CAPA implementation.
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Pharmacy, Pharmaceutical Sciences, Biotechnology, or a related field.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making abilities, with attention to detail and a focus on quality and efficiency.
  • Effective communication skills and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ams and external auditors or regulatory bodies.
  • Willingness to work on-site in Bahadurgarh and adapt to a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
